* build: add oxfmt for code formatting and import sorting

Adds oxfmt as a devDependency alongside oxlint and wires it into the
lint pipeline. The .oxfmtrc.json config matches Electron's current JS
style (single quotes, semicolons, 2-space indent, trailing commas off,
printWidth 100) and configures sortImports with custom groups that
mirror the import/order pathGroups previously enforced by ESLint:
@electron/internal, @electron/*, and {electron,electron/**} each get
their own ordered group ahead of external modules.

- `yarn lint:fmt` runs `oxfmt --check` over JS/TS sources and is
  chained into `yarn lint` so CI enforces it automatically.
- `yarn format` runs `oxfmt --write` for local fix-up.
- lint-staged invokes `oxfmt --write` on staged .js/.ts/.mjs/.cjs
  files before oxlint, so formatting is applied at commit time.

The next commit applies the formatter to the existing codebase so the
check actually passes.

* chore: apply oxfmt formatting to JS and TS sources

Runs `yarn format` across lib/, spec/, script/, build/, default_app/,
and npm/ to bring the codebase in line with the .oxfmtrc.json settings
added in the previous commit. This is a pure formatting pass: import
statements are sorted into the groups defined by the config, method
chains longer than printWidth are broken, single-quoted strings
containing apostrophes are switched to double quotes, and a handful of
single-statement `if` bodies are re-wrapped and get braces added by
`oxlint --fix` to satisfy the `curly: multi-line` rule.

No behavior changes.

#!/usr/bin/env node
const { downloadArtifact } = require('@electron/get');
const extract = require('extract-zip');
const childProcess = require('child_process');
const fs = require('fs');
const os = require('os');
const path = require('path');
const { version } = require('./package');
const platformPath = getPlatformPath();
if (isInstalled()) {
process.exit(0);
}
const platform = process.env.ELECTRON_INSTALL_PLATFORM || process.env.npm_config_platform || process.platform;
let arch = process.env.ELECTRON_INSTALL_ARCH || process.env.npm_config_arch || process.arch;
if (
platform === 'darwin' &&
process.platform === 'darwin' &&
arch === 'x64' &&
process.env.npm_config_arch === undefined
) {
// When downloading for macOS ON macOS and we think we need x64 we should
// check if we're running under rosetta and download the arm64 version if appropriate
try {
const output = childProcess.execSync('sysctl -in sysctl.proc_translated');
if (output.toString().trim() === '1') {
arch = 'arm64';
}
} catch {
// Ignore failure
}
}
// downloads if not cached
downloadArtifact({
version,
artifactName: 'electron',
force: process.env.force_no_cache === 'true',
cacheRoot: process.env.electron_config_cache,
checksums:
process.env.electron_use_remote_checksums || process.env.npm_config_electron_use_remote_checksums
? undefined
: require('./checksums.json'),
platform,
arch
})
.then(extractFile)
.catch((err) => {
console.error(err.stack);
process.exit(1);
});
function isInstalled() {
try {
if (fs.readFileSync(path.join(__dirname, 'dist', 'version'), 'utf-8').replace(/^v/, '') !== version) {
return false;
}
if (fs.readFileSync(path.join(__dirname, 'path.txt'), 'utf-8') !== platformPath) {
return false;
}
} catch {
return false;
}
const electronPath = process.env.ELECTRON_OVERRIDE_DIST_PATH || path.join(__dirname, 'dist', platformPath);
return fs.existsSync(electronPath);
}
// unzips and makes path.txt point at the correct executable
function extractFile(zipPath) {
const distPath = process.env.ELECTRON_OVERRIDE_DIST_PATH || path.join(__dirname, 'dist');
return extract(zipPath, { dir: path.join(__dirname, 'dist') }).then(() => {
// If the zip contains an "electron.d.ts" file,
// move that up
const srcTypeDefPath = path.join(distPath, 'electron.d.ts');
const targetTypeDefPath = path.join(__dirname, 'electron.d.ts');
const hasTypeDefinitions = fs.existsSync(srcTypeDefPath);
if (hasTypeDefinitions) {
fs.renameSync(srcTypeDefPath, targetTypeDefPath);
}
// Write a "path.txt" file.
return fs.promises.writeFile(path.join(__dirname, 'path.txt'), platformPath);
});
}
function getPlatformPath() {
const platform = process.env.npm_config_platform || os.platform();
switch (platform) {
case 'mas':
case 'darwin':
return 'Electron.app/Contents/MacOS/Electron';
case 'freebsd':
case 'openbsd':
case 'linux':
return 'electron';
case 'win32':
return 'electron.exe';
default:
throw new Error('Electron builds are not available on platform: ' + platform);
}
}
